E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
螺旋数组
leetcode(力扣) 55. 跳跃游戏 (贪心 & 动态规划)
文章目录题目描述思路分析贪心思路:动态规划思路:完整代码题目描述给定一个非负整数
数组
nums,你最初位于
数组
的第一个下标。
数组
中的每个元素代表你在该位置可以跳跃的最大长度。
深度不学习!!
·
2024-03-08 00:51
个人笔记
交流学习
leetcode
python
Python·算法·每日一题(3月6日)最接近的三数之和
题目给你一个长度为n的整数
数组
nums和一个目标值target。请你从nums中选出三个整数,使它们的和与target最接近。返回这三个数的和。假定每组输入只存在恰好一个解。
时光不染,回忆不淡୧⍤⃝
·
2024-03-07 23:20
python·每日一题
算法
python
leetcode
python size和shape
numpy数据类型对于numpy中的
数组
:shape:获得维度x.shape这里shape为x的属性,不需要加括号numpy.shape(x)这里的shape()是numpy的内置函数size:获得元素个数
MORE_77
·
2024-03-07 23:20
python
开发语言
JavaScript进阶-内置构造函数
文章目录内置构造函数引用类型ObjectArray
数组
常见的实例方法-核心方法
数组
常见方法-其他方法
数组
常见方法-伪
数组
转换为正
数组
包装类型String常见实例方法Number内置构造函数引用类型Object
jl_3288
·
2024-03-07 22:48
JavaScript
javascript
开发语言
ecmascript
设计模式-builder模式
缺点:随着属性增加,构造器的参
数组
合呈指数级增长,难以维护和理解。publicclassProduct{privateStringproperty1;privateintpro
代码匠心印记
·
2024-03-07 21:47
设计模式
设计模式
建造者模式
java
leetcode 2917.找出
数组
中的K-or值
说实话这道题就是阅读题。虽然作者本题写的并不怎么简单,但是思路还是很清楚的。思路:通过题目我们就可以知道,本质上就是算出这个数的二进制,然后在二进制中找到各位有多少1的题目而已。intn=nums.size();intarr[51][32];for(inti=0;i=k,那么我们直接储存这里的坐标i,否则继续循环。最后退出循环整个结束之后,我们就按照题目所给的方式求解最终的数就行了。classSo
是小Y啦
·
2024-03-07 16:09
leetcode
算法
数据结构
1、let、const、var区别、解构赋值、新增字符串语法、
数组
方法、网址组成
一、let、const、var的区别*1、let和var的区别相同点:在全局声明的就是全局变量,在局部声明的变量是局部变量不同点(4条):let声明的变量不能提升let声明的变量名不能重复声明let声明的变量只在当前的块作用域中有效{}let声明的变量会产生暂时性的死区,只能在当前块作用域中查找if(false){varnum=20letnum1=20}console.log(num)//unde
@zyf哈哈哈哈
·
2024-03-07 12:04
javascript
前端
vue.js
将List转换为
数组
或者将
数组
转换为List,如果改变了原始值,转换后的数据会发生改变吗?
将List转换为
数组
或将
数组
转换为List涉及到数据结构的变化。在Java中,这两种转换是否会影响原始数据取决于转换的方式和使用的数据结构。
来自宇宙的曹先生
·
2024-03-07 10:02
list
数据结构
java
数组
LeetCode每日一题 汇总区间(区间)
题目描述给定一个无重复元素的有序整数
数组
nums。返回恰好覆盖
数组
中所有数字的最小有序区间范围列表。
南瓜小米粥、
·
2024-03-07 05:26
leetcode
算法
数据结构
算法题合集(细分知识点附链接)---------第二部分【融合牛客及力扣】
算法题合集图137.只出现一次的数字II260.只出现一次的数字IIIJZ39
数组
中出现次数超过一半的数字树606.根据二叉树创建字符串102.二叉树的层序遍历236.二叉树的最近公共祖先JZ36二叉搜索树与双向链表
FreedanyTsui
·
2024-03-07 02:52
各种算法题
算法
23. 合并 K 个升序链表
给你一个链表
数组
,每个链表都已经按升序排列。请你将所有链表合并到一个升序链表中,返回合并后的链表。
colorful_stars
·
2024-03-06 22:49
C++
算法
C/C++
链表
算法
数据结构
c++
leetcode
vue element plus Cascader 级联选择器
TIP在SSR场景下,您需要将组件包裹在之中(如:Nuxt)和SSG(e.g:VitePress).基础用法#有两种触发子菜单的方式只需为Cascader的options属性指定选项
数组
即可渲染出一个级联选择器
跟Bug双向奔赴
·
2024-03-06 21:48
vue.js
elementui
javascript
二分法
折半查找
数组
元素二分查找(折半查找)解题步骤:定义3个用来记录索引值的变量,变量min记录当前范围最小索引值,初始值为0;变量max记录当前范围最大索引值,初始值为
数组
长度-1;变量mid记录当前当前范围最中间元素的索引值
谷枭枭
·
2024-03-06 12:06
查找
JAVA
代码随想录算法训练营Day20 || leetCode 530.二叉搜索树的最小绝对差 || 501.二叉搜索树中的众数 || 236. 二叉树的最近公共祖先
530.二叉搜索树的最小绝对差最简单的思路为中序遍历,然后遍历
数组
求差值。
qq_44884699
·
2024-03-06 10:04
算法
leetcode
职场和发展
np.hstack(), np.concatenate()与np.stack()解析
np.hstack(),np.concatenate()与np.stack()是numpy中实现
数组
拼接的三个函数。
眠眠菇
·
2024-03-06 04:57
Python数据分析
python
numpy
【Python】查看张量(tensor)数据维度和每一维大小示例
随机生成一个张量
数组
:importtorcha=torch.rand(1,3,480,640)然后使用.shape查看
数组
维度,输入:x=a.shapeprint(x)输出:torch.Size([1,3,480,640
木彳
·
2024-03-06 04:56
Python学习和使用过程积累
python
深度学习
人工智能
计算机视觉
力扣爆刷第85天之hot100五连刷11-15
力扣爆刷第85天之hot100五连刷11-15文章目录力扣爆刷第85天之hot100五连刷11-15一、239.滑动窗口最大值二、76.最小覆盖子串三、53.最大子
数组
和四、56.合并区间五、189.轮转
数组
一
当年拼却醉颜红
·
2024-03-06 01:23
力扣算法题
leetcode
算法
职场和发展
c++算法学习,力扣刷题笔记
c++算法学习,力扣刷题笔记目录c++算法学习,力扣刷题笔记新手村1480.一维
数组
的动态和1480.一维
数组
的动态和C++中的位运算符例子更多位运算用法具体示例1672.最富有客户的资产总量新手村力扣新手村题目及解析
黒№
·
2024-03-06 00:22
c++
算法
leetcode 673.最长递增子序列的个数
上一题只需要知道最长递增子序列的长度就行了,那样的话直接一个dp就完事了,但是呢,这里说了需要记录这个最长长度递增子序列的个数,这下的话,如果你想用原先的思路,其实可以,但是要能做到计数的话,需要你再定义一个
数组
是小Y啦
·
2024-03-06 00:22
leetcode
算法
动态规划
魔法少女Scarlet
题目描述Scarlet最近学会了一个
数组
魔法,她会在n×n二维
数组
上将一个奇数阶方阵按照顺时针或者逆时针旋转90∘。
听情歌落俗
·
2024-03-05 22:48
算法
学习札记-Java8系列-10-详解Stream操作
学习札记-Java8系列-10-详解Stream操作操作步骤使用StreamAPI操作数据可以分为以下几个步骤:1)创建流:通过数据源(如:集合、
数组
)获取流2)处理流:(中的数据)对流中的数据进行处理
你的学习札记
·
2024-03-05 16:18
两个
数组
的交集202. 快乐数1.两数之和
*/varisAnagram=function(s,t){returns.split('').sort().join('')===t.split('').sort().join('')};349.两个
数组
的交集思路
shjavadown
·
2024-03-05 14:37
算法
算法|454.四数相加II 383. 赎金信 15. 三数之和 18. 四数之和
454.四数相加II思路:a,b,c,d四个
数组
,1,循环把a,b两个
数组
的值相加并存入map中,key为和,value为出现的次数2,循环c,d2个
数组
,将结果和map中对比0-sum/***@param
shjavadown
·
2024-03-05 14:37
算法
Leetcode 3070. Count Submatrices with Top-Left Element and Sum Less Than k
CountSubmatriceswithTop-LeftElementandSumLessThank1.解题思路2.代码实现题目链接:3070.CountSubmatriceswithTop-LeftElementandSumLessThank1.解题思路这一题就是一个二维的累积
数组
的问题
Espresso Macchiato
·
2024-03-05 06:28
leetcode笔记
leetcode
3070
leetcode周赛387
leetcode
medium
二维累积数组
leetcode题解
309. 买卖股票的最佳时机含冷冻期
给定一个整数
数组
prices,其中第prices[i]表示第i天的股票价格。设计一个算法计算出最大利润。
南屿欣风
·
2024-03-05 06:57
算法
数据结构
5.应用管理
同时sleep指令要求传入一个时间参数我们以shell形式或JSON
数组
格式传入,要求执行sleep5秒钟JSON的第一位应该是可执行文件FROMubuntu#CMDsleep5CMD["sleep",
奔强的程序
·
2024-03-05 05:56
kubernetes
重拾C++之菜鸟刷算法第4篇---哈希表
一、有效的字母异位词知识点统计字母个数操作技巧record[s[i]-'a']++;
数组
也是哈希表哦~题目给定两个字符串*s*和
阿卡西番茄酱
·
2024-03-05 00:49
C++算法
leetcode
算法
哈希算法
Java之美[从菜鸟到高手演变]之Java中的
数组
数组
是一种基础数据结构,任何一门程序设计语言都提供了对它的支持。一般来说,
数组
具有使用简单,适用范围广的特点。
依琳小师妹
·
2024-03-04 21:17
java
开发语言
位运算的妙用
异或:性质:a^a=0;a^0=a;满足交换律和结合律下面我们来看一道妙用异或的题:给定一个
数组
,这个
数组
中有一个数字出现过奇数次,而其他数字出现过偶数次,找出这个数字。
·
2024-03-04 19:59
算法位运算
java
数组
定义:是储存同一种数据类型多个元素的集合结构:数据类型[]
数组
名=初值列如:int[]array=newint[5];就是创建一个int类型
数组
长度为的
数组
。
总被Gy骗
·
2024-03-04 16:39
数据结构
【数据结构】_包装类与泛型
装箱与自动(显式)拆箱1.3valueOf()方法2.泛型类2.1泛型类与Object类2.2泛型类语法2.3泛型类示例2.4裸类型(RawType)2.5泛型类的编译2.5.1擦除机制2.5.2泛型类型
数组
的实例化
_周游
·
2024-03-04 08:59
数据结构(Java)
数据结构
java
weak的实现原理
iOS在运行时维护着一个全局的弱引用表,该表是一个hash表,hash表的key是对象本身,value是指向该对象的所有weak指针的地址
数组
。
猴叻鳢
·
2024-03-04 08:58
iOS核心知识点
objective-c
weak
原理
面试
内存管理
【LeetCode-中等】209.长度最小的子
数组
-双指针/滑动窗口
力扣题目链接1.暴力解法这道题的暴力解法是两层嵌套for循环,第一层循环从i=0开始遍历至
数组
末尾,第二层循环从j=i开始遍历至找到总和大于等于target的连续子
数组
,并将该连续子
数组
的长度与之前找到的子
数组
长度相比较
qmkn
·
2024-03-04 07:27
LeetCode
leetcode
算法
滑动窗口
System Verilog学习笔记(十二)——
数组
(2)
SystemVerilog学习笔记(十二)——
数组
(2)动态
数组
在编译时不会为其定制尺寸,而是在仿真运行时来确定动态
数组
一开始为空,需要使用new[]来为其分配空间声明方式intdyn[],d2[];/
颖子爱学习
·
2024-03-04 07:27
System
Verilog学习笔记
学习
笔记
牛客寒假基础集训营 | 技巧总结
自己思考,用笔划划,用心理解算法,不要先看代码做一道题,会一道题,追求解题质量,不要贪恋速度举一反三举具体例子,便于理解,捋清思路Day1技巧使用vector
数组
存储字符串中不同字符的下标。
大虎牙
·
2024-03-04 01:19
#
牛客寒假基础集训营
牛客寒假基础集训营
牛客
技巧
Numpy快速入门(1)
二、基础知识1.
数组
创建2.
数组
的索引、切片和迭代3.形状操纵一、Numpy是什么? NumPy是一个开源的Python库,提供了多维
数组
对象(ndarray)和用于处理这些
数组
的函数。
胡乱儿起个名
·
2024-03-04 00:47
python基础
numpy
javascript操作
数组
的方法
push()//在
数组
末尾添加一个或多个元素letarr=["apple","banana","orange"];arr.push("grape","melon");console.log(arr);/
riyue666
·
2024-03-03 22:16
javascript
javascript
uniapp的动态表单实现
目录1.说明2.示例3.总结1.说明①在formData中定义个
数组
变量用来接受同一个字段的多个结果。
linab112
·
2024-03-03 10:29
uni-app
uni-app
C语言函数
数组
实现扫雷游戏
如果我们想用C语言学过的函数
数组
的方法写一个扫雷游戏,应该怎么来做呢?
A铁锅炖咸鱼
·
2024-03-03 08:27
c语言
游戏
开发语言
【PTA|客观题|期末复习】指针(一)
TF1-6
数组
的基地址是在内存中存储
数组
的起始位置,
数组
名本身
La_gloire
·
2024-03-03 03:20
PTA
数据结构
c语言
Java:性能优化细节31-45
Vector是一个同步的集合类,提供了动态
数组
的实现。由于它是线程安全的,所以在单线程应用中可能会出现不必要的性能开销。
孙霸天
·
2024-03-03 02:20
Java
java
性能优化
开发语言
next
数组
?前缀表?菜鸟重拾C++之算法
实现strStr()知识点KMP(Knuth-Morris-Pratt)算法是一种用于字符串匹配的高效算法。其原理基于字符串匹配时的特性,通过预处理模式字符串(待匹配字符串)的信息,避免在匹配过程中重复比较已经匹配过的部分。前缀表记录了模式字符串中最长相同前后缀的长度前缀是指不包含最后一个字符的所有以第一个字符开头的连续子串。后缀是指不包含第一个字符的所有以最后一个字符结尾的连续子串。最长相同前后
阿卡西番茄酱
·
2024-03-02 21:42
C++算法
算法
c++
leetcode
无人驾驶 OpenCV (F) 识别车道线
cropped_image,2,np.pi/180,100,np.array([]),minLineLength=40,maxLineGap=5)第一参数是我们要检查的图片Houghaccumulator
数组
第二个和第三个参数用于定义我们
zidea
·
2024-03-02 18:16
二维
数组
求矩阵的局部极大值
答案:#includeintmain(){intm,n,i,j;scanf("%d%d",&m,&n);inta[m][n];for(i=0;ia[i][j+1]&&a[i][j]>a[i][j-1]&&a[i][j]>a[i-1][j]&&a[i][j]>a[i+1][j]){printf("%d%d%d\n",a[i][j],i+1,j+1);fact=1;}}if(fact==0)print
天地过客1124
·
2024-03-02 15:33
矩阵
算法
c语言
算法:找出一个
数组
中出现次数最多的元素
找出一个
数组
中出现次数最多的元素使用对象记录元素出现次数:functionfindMostFrequentElement(arr){letcount={};letmaxCount=0;letmostFrequentElement
前端fighter
·
2024-03-02 07:19
前端算法
算法
javascript
前端
【C++】一个求
数组
中最大元素的函数模板
题目设计一个分数类FractionFractionFraction,再设计一个名为MaxelementMax_elementMaxelement的函数模板,能够求
数组
中最大的元素,并用该模板求一个FractionFractionFraction
AC2656
·
2024-03-02 04:46
C++面向对象
c++
模拟、排序(归并排序)算法
1、错误票据题目信息思路题解2、回文日期题目信息思路方法一:暴力做法方法二:优化解法题解方法一:暴力求解方法二:优化解法二、排序例题1、归并排序题目信息思路题解一、模拟例题1、错误票据题目信息思路先对
数组
进行排序
东东不熬夜
·
2024-03-02 03:45
算法
算法
c++
重新组织数据
以对象取代数据值要点:你有一个数据项,需要与其他数据和行为一起使用才有意义3)将值对象改为引用对象(单例)要点:你从一个类衍生许多彼此相等的实例,希望将他们替换成同一个对象4)以对象取代数据要点:你有一个
数组
陈桐Caliburn
·
2024-03-02 02:21
LeetCode 2670.找出不同元素数目差
数组
给你一个下标从0开始的
数组
nums,
数组
长度为n。
吃着火锅x唱着歌
·
2024-03-02 01:42
LeetCode
leetcode
算法
数据结构
Java_3_集合框架
一、思维导图Java集合框架.xmind二、知识点及实践2.1、CollectionList列表(元素有序并且可以重复的集合,被称为序列)1.ArrayList排列有序,可重复底层使用
数组
查询快,增删慢线程不安全当容量不够时
·
2024-03-01 17:41
java
上一页
25
26
27
28
29
30
31
32
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他